Softball 3/1/2022 10:49:39 AM Badger, Matter Shine, Earn #AESB Week #2 Awards BOSTON – Three #AESB teams took the field last week and two of them put up strong showings. Stony Brook kicked off its season by going 4-1 in Miami. The Seawolves were powered by Player of the Week Corinne Badger, who whacked six home runs in the five games. Two-time reigning champion UMBC also put on a strong showing going 3-1. Freshman hurler Kya Matter was the star for the Retrievers, hurling a no-hitter in just her second career start, a 1-0 win over Coppin State. She also set a program record with 18 strikeouts in the game, which is the most by any pitcher in the country so far this season. Four programs are in action this weekend including Stony Brook, which makes its 2022 debut. Follow the @AEGameDay Twitter account to stay up-to-date on America East softball news all season long and use #AESB to join the conversation. #AESB Weekly Award Winners – March 1 Player of the Week Corinne Badger, Stony Brook - Jr., Catcher, Pleasant, N.Y. Racked up an impressive 2.571 OPS hitting .500 with a 2.000 slugging percentage in five games last week. All six of her hits were home runs. Drove in 11 runs and scored six. This is Badger’s first career Player of the Week honor. Pitcher & Rookie of the Week Kya Matter, UMBC – Fr., Pitcher, Dalmatia, Pa. Went 2-0 while allowing only two earned runs in 14 innings pitched. Struck out 31. Highlight of the week was one of the best pitching performances by anyone this season to date as she hurled a no-hitter with 18 Ks and only one walk in a 1-0 win over Coppin State on Saturday.
